Benefits of a Bio Ethanol Fireplace
Consider a bio-ethanol fire place If you're looking to build an actual flame and heat, but don't require a chimney or a flue. It is safe to use so long as you follow some basic precautions. Use only e-NRG liquid alcohol and don't add any other materials to the burner.
No chimney or flue
A bio-ethanol fireplace does not require a chimney or a flue. It can be installed in any room in your home, without requiring structural modifications. It's also less expensive than a traditional gas fireplace.
Most bio ethanol fireplaces have an adjustable burner, which allows you to regulate the size of the flame. This allows you to efficiently heat your room and efficiently. If you prefer, you can also use fake flues to give the fireplace a more authentic appearance.
Ethanol fireplaces do not produce smoke, ash, or carbon monoxide, making them safe and simple to install and operate. It is essential to keep in mind that bio-ethanol fireplaces should not be used in proximity to anything that could ignite. To decrease the risk of an accidental fire it is recommended that flammable supplies and materials be kept at least 1500mm from your fireplace. Do not place combustible items or objects on the top of the fire. This could cause the flame to rise and ignite any combustible objects that are beneath it.
A litre of fuel can warm a room up to 5m x 5m for three hours. This will keep you and your family warm all winter.
Certain fireplaces made of bio-ethanol come with the ability to control the flame remotely. you to control the flame and heat from the comfort of your couch. This feature is particularly beneficial when there are pets or children in the house. It is also possible to install bio-ethanol fireplaces into a wall. Most of these styles come with extensions and brackets that allow them to be mounted to a flat or sloping wall.

No carbon monoxide
In contrast to propane gas, wood and other kinds of fireplace fuel bioethanol doesn't release carbon monoxide or other harmful substances when it is burned. This is because bio ethanol burns completely leaving only heat and water. This does not mean that you should only rely on an ethanol-fired furnace as your primary heat source. It's still necessary to have an additional source of heat.

Easy to install
Ethanol fireplaces are easy to set up. They don't require chimneys or flue, and can be installed virtually anywhere, including inside your home or in a garden shed. The fuel burns cleanly, which means there's no smoke or ash. Indoor air pollution is also minimal. And they're more affordable than traditional wood burning stoves.
It is also easy to make use of bio ethanol fires. Simply add a small amount of fuel into the burner and then light it up. You can control the size of the flame by using the regulator rod. You can put out a flame by pushing the lid on top of the opening.
